How Can Pain And Heavy Bleeding Be Managed In A Woman Suffering From Ovarian Cyst?

Hi doc. I am a person who suffers from ovarian cyst and it makes my period heavy and painful. I had my first depo shot last month (20June) and since that i haven t stop bleeding. The bleeding is not too heavy but i am worried now because it s been a month now. At the clinic where i got the depo shot, they gave me oralcon tablets and now is my second day taking it. I was asking if it will stop the bleeding or not

Hi,

An ultrasound scan is necessary to rule out possible etiologies of bleeding. Pills may help you stop the bleeding.
